4/17/2014 0 Comments Camera Ready!In the midst of preparing for my sister's baby shower, a baker friend of mine who makes the best cupcakes I've ever had, commissioned some fondant work from me: fondant camera cupcake toppers for a photographer's birthday. I've never done cupcake toppers before, so I was happy to do them! She wanted DSLR type cameras, so I did some research and looked at the different DSLR cameras on the market these days (specifically CANON) plus, other ways folks have done them. This was also the first time I timed myself working on things, because it was getting late and I really needed to get some sleep! These 4 little cameras took just a little under 3 hours, and i started to rush it at the end too.
